It is a school managed by autonomous body Kendriya Vidyalaya Sangathan under the aegis of Ministry of Education (earlier MHRD),Govt. of India. People have so many misconceptions about this school.
Let me quash them one by one.
1.The school wastes time on CCA-No, I have worked 16 years in Govt schools and more or less government programmes and observance days are observed everywhere particularly after communication of circulars and data collection have become easier after cheap data availability. All that matters is the importance of CCA in one's career.Your talent is tested in written exams but your job is secured after you face an interview/viva voce.Ask me what it not does !! Your speaking, expression, hobby , interests are tested.The latest trend is that If you know dancing they would like to know how much you can paint. CCA is never a wastage of time rather an edge to your talent.
2.Teachers do not complete syllabus on time.
It is a universal phenomenon when the available instruction time is decreasing and depth of concepts are increasing and if it is expected from the teacher to complete it in 6 months (by November) then maybe syllabi need modifications ,not the teachers dedication.Classroom discipline and completion of home work help syllabus move swiftly but that is sometimes not under the teachers control.
3.This school has bad discipline-
Not at all. This is the most disciplined school in the town, save the fact that some undisciplined students take time to induct the values and culture of the school. They engage in vandalization and can't tolerate power failure or water shortage if ever occurs thinking that they are paying for it.But they pay for it !!! No school ensures A/C and Diesel generator (edit: MCL has donated a Diesel Generator set lately with 12 KvA capacity, it is used during exam and other important office work).With Rs600 to 1000 fees monthly, that too with
partial or complete fee exemption from almost 50% students and the school share from it is VVN only with no direct power of spending by the administrator it is unwise to compare it with non-govt schools who have unlimited autonomy.
4.Teachers are engaged in private tuition: It is against the KVS codes. No regular teacher is doing private tuition nor they recommend private tuitions which is just an extra burden on students lifestyle. (It is an addiction which spoils self-learning skills). Ad-hoc teachers are not bound by any rule to refrain from private tuition. However, they cannot ask or compel anyone to join their tuition nor can they discriminate on the basis of it. All the faculty members are so nice that they cannot think of doing so.(Records prove that private tuitions have done little good to students).
